One of the primary problems that window remodeling addresses is energy inefficiency. Older windows often lack proper insulation, leading to heat loss during colder months and heat gain in warmer seasons. Remodeling can help seal leaks and improve insulation, which may result in better temperature regulation and potential energy savings. Additionally, window upgrades can resolve issues such as drafts, condensation between panes, or difficulty operating windows due to warping or damage. These improvements can also enhance security and reduce noise infiltration, making the property more comfortable and secure.

The overview below groups typical Window Remodeling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Abington,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Window Replacement Costs - The cost for replacing windows typ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size, material, and style. For example, a standard double-pane window in Abington, MA, might fall within this range. Prices can vary based on the complexity of installation and window type.
Frame Material Expenses - The choice of frame material impacts overall costs, with vinyl frames generally costing between $100 and $300 per window. Aluminum or wood frames may increase the price to $400 or more per window.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ific material preferences.
Labor and Installation Fees - Labor costs for window remodeling services often range from $150 to $500 per window. Factors influencing this include window size, installation complexity, and local labor rates. Contact local service providers for precise quotes tailored to project scope.
Additional Costs to Consider - Upgrades such as energy-efficient glass or custom designs can add $200 to $600 per window. These enhancements may improve insulation and aesthetics but will increase the overall project budget. Local pros can advise on options suitable for properties in Abington, MA.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
